Transaction 17e0c55c6072994d6dabf3eb7fa724bc6a81b83cbdcaad055a0e88bc06c9fdf5
1 Input
1 Output
-
17e0c55c6072994d6dabf3eb7fa724bc6a81b83cbdcaad055a0e88bc06c9fdf5:0
- value
- 2386295
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ed601f6326dea4168491dec71502b735d815cd0e
- address
- bc1qa4sp7cexm6jpdpy3mmr32q4hxhvptngw7tp0ly